संसाधन: Groupसदस्य
ग्रुप का वह सदस्य जिसे किसी ग्रुप को असाइन किया गया है.
JSON के काेड में दिखाना |
---|
{
"name": string,
"details": {
object ( |
फ़ील्ड | |
---|---|
name |
ज़रूरी है. सदस्य का नाम. |
details |
सिर्फ़ आउटपुट के लिए. ग्रुप के सदस्य के बारे में ज़्यादा जानकारी, जैसे कि चेक इन करने का इतिहास. |
GroupMemberDetails
ग्रुप के किसी सदस्य के बारे में जानकारी, जैसे कि हार्डवेयर आईडी और रजिस्ट्रेशन का समय. यह सारी जानकारी सिर्फ़ पढ़ने के लिए होती है.
JSON के काेड में दिखाना |
---|
{ "hardwareId": [ { object ( |
फ़ील्ड | |
---|---|
hardwareId[] |
डिवाइस से जुड़े हार्डवेयर आईडी (IMEi, meid, सीरियल वगैरह) की सूची. |
registerTime |
डिवाइस के पहली बार रजिस्टर होने के समय का टाइमस्टैंप. आरएफ़सी3339 यूटीसी "ज़ुलु" में टाइमस्टैंप फ़ॉर्मैट, नैनोसेकंड रिज़ॉल्यूशन और ज़्यादा से ज़्यादा नौ फ़्रैक्शनल अंकों के साथ हो सकता है. उदाहरण: |
hardwareName |
हार्डवेयर का नाम, जैसे कि शमू. |
currentOta |
मौजूदा ओटीए नाम. |
checkins[] |
चेक-इन का इतिहास. |
lastCheckin |
पिछली बार चेक इन करने का समय. |
HardwareID
डिवाइस से जुड़ा हार्डवेयर आईडी.
JSON के काेड में दिखाना |
---|
{ "id": string } |
फ़ील्ड | |
---|---|
id |
फ़ॉर्मैट किया गया आईडी, जैसे कि imei:XYZ. |
OtaProperties
मौजूदा डिवाइस ओटीए की प्रॉपर्टी के लिए मैसेज.
JSON के काेड में दिखाना |
---|
{ "name": string, "url": string } |
फ़ील्ड | |
---|---|
name |
ओटीए का नाम. |
url |
ओटीए का यूआरएल. |
चेकइन
एक डिवाइस चेक-इन.
JSON के काेड में दिखाना |
---|
{
"checkinTime": string,
"buildProperties": {
object ( |
फ़ील्ड | |
---|---|
checkinTime |
चेक-इन होने का टाइमस्टैंप. सिर्फ़ तब अपने-आप जानकारी भर जाती है, जब डिवाइस किसी ग्रुप में होता है. आरएफ़सी3339 यूटीसी "ज़ुलु" में टाइमस्टैंप फ़ॉर्मैट, नैनोसेकंड रिज़ॉल्यूशन और ज़्यादा से ज़्यादा नौ फ़्रैक्शनल अंकों के साथ हो सकता है. उदाहरण: |
buildProperties |
प्रॉपर्टी बनाएं. |
roOemKey1 |
मौजूद होने पर ro.oem.key1 का मान. |
AndroidBuildProperties
डिवाइस की बिल्ड प्रॉपर्टी चेक-इन के साथ भेजी गईं.
JSON के काेड में दिखाना |
---|
{ "id": string, "product": string, "radio": string, "bootloader": string } |
फ़ील्ड | |
---|---|
id |
पूरा बिल्ड आईडी. |
product |
प्रॉडक्ट = ro.build.product, जैसे कि शमू. |
radio |
रेडियो. |
bootloader |
बूटलोडर. |
LastCheckin
पिछली बार चेक इन करने की जानकारी. checkin_history
फ़ील्ड में मौजूद आइटम के मुकाबले, इसमें ज़्यादा जानकारी होती है.
JSON के काेड में दिखाना |
---|
{ "checkin": { object ( |
फ़ील्ड | |
---|---|
checkin |
बेस चेक-इन प्रॉपर्टी. |
digest |
डिवाइस पर वापस भेजे गए नतीजे का हैश, अगर कोई हो. |
locale |
स्थान-भाषा. |
extraBuildProperties[] |
अतिरिक्त बिल्ड प्रॉपर्टी, जैसे कि ro.build.[device|client] |
timeWindow |
पिछले चेकइन की समयावधि |
KeyValue
OTA API प्रोटो के लिए KeyValue मैसेज.
JSON के काेड में दिखाना |
---|
{ "key": string, "value": string } |
फ़ील्ड | |
---|---|
key |
कुंजी. |
value |
मान. |
TimeWindow
वह आखिरी विंडो जिसमें डिवाइस ने चेक इन किया था.
Enums | |
---|---|
TIME_WINDOW_UNSPECIFIED |
अज्ञात |
TIME_WINDOW_WITHIN_ONE_DAY |
एक दिन के अंदर |
TIME_WINDOW_WITHIN_ONE_WEEK |
पिछले हफ़्ते |
TIME_WINDOW_WITHIN_TWO_WEEKS |
पिछले दो हफ़्तों में |
TIME_WINDOW_MORE_THAN_TWO_WEEKS |
पिछले दो हफ़्तों से ज़्यादा |
तरीके |
|
---|---|
|
किसी खास ग्रुप में ग्रुप के सदस्य बनाता है. |
|
किसी ग्रुप से ग्रुप के सदस्यों को मिटाता है. |
|
ग्रुप का सदस्य बनाता है और नया GroupMember दिखाता है. |
|
group member को मिटाता है. |
|
group member मिलता है. |
|
सूची group members . |